Description CUJO AI delivers advanced AI-driven cybersecurity and network intelligence platforms specifically designed for broadband and mobile network operators. It provides comprehensive solutions to protect connected devices within subscriber networks, enhance overall network performance, and generate actionable data insights. These capabilities enable operators to improve subscriber services, reduce operational costs, and unlock new revenue opportunities through a secure and optimized network infrastructure. Nayla is an AI-powered browser and comprehensive workspace meticulously designed to significantly enhance online productivity and research efficiency. It seamlessly integrates advanced AI capabilities directly into the browsing experience, offering features like instant content summarization, intelligent text generation, real-time translation, and smart information organization. This innovative tool aims to automate tedious, repetitive online tasks and streamline various digital workflows, empowering individuals and teams to optimize their web interactions and focus on higher-value activities.
What It Does The tool leverages artificial intelligence and machine learning to analyze network traffic, identify connected devices, detect and prevent cyber threats, and monitor network performance in real-time. It provides operators with deep visibility into their networks and subscriber behavior, enabling proactive security measures and data-driven service enhancements. Nayla functions as an AI co-pilot embedded within your browser, leveraging artificial intelligence to analyze web content on demand. It provides concise summaries of articles, videos, and documents, generates new text based on user prompts, and translates entire web pages or selected text in real-time. Furthermore, Nayla enables users to create custom automation workflows for tasks such as data extraction or report generation, while intelligently organizing all saved information within its dedicated workspace for easy retrieval.
